Kia Sportage VS Suzuki S-Cross – Specs, Efficiency & Price Comparison

Which model is the better choice – the Kia Sportage or the Suzuki S-Cross? We compare performance (252 HP vs 129 HP), boot capacity (587 L vs 430 L), efficiency (1.20 L vs 5.10 L), and of course, the price (29700 £ vs 21400 £).
Find out now which car fits your needs better!

The Kia Sportage (SUV) is powered by a Diesel MHEV, Petrol MHEV, Full Hybrid, Petrol or Plugin Hybrid engine and comes with a Manuel or Automatic transmission. In comparison, the Suzuki S-Cross (SUV) features a Full Hybrid or Petrol MHEV engine and a Automatic or Manuel gearbox.

When it comes to boot capacity, the Kia Sportage offers 587 L, while the Suzuki S-Cross provides 430 L – depending on what matters most to you. If you’re looking for more power, you’ll need to decide whether the 252 HP of the Kia Sportage or the 129 HP of the Suzuki S-Cross suits your needs better.

There are also differences in efficiency: 1.20 L vs 5.10 L. In terms of price, the Kia Sportage starts at 29700 £, while the Suzuki S-Cross is available from 21400 £.

The Kia Sportage: A Technological Masterpiece

The Kia Sportage has been a stalwart in the SUV segment, consistently offering excellent value, style, and performance. In its latest iteration, the Sportage pushes the boundaries with a fusion of advanced technology and innovative design, making it an enticing option for all types of drivers.

Power and Performance: The Heart of the Sportage

The new Kia Sportage boasts a broad range of powertrain options, ensuring there's something for everyone. Engines vary from efficient diesel mild-hybrids, petrol mild-hybrids, full hybrids, to cutting-edge plug-in hybrids. Output ranges from a nimble 136 PS to a robust 252 PS, providing a balance between efficiency and exhilarating performance.

The plug-in hybrid variant, in particular, sets new standards with an impressive electric range of 64 km, and a combined fuel consumption of merely 1.2 L/100km, positioning it as a leader in eco-friendly engineering.

Transmission and Drivetrain Advancements

The Sportage offers both manual and automatic transmission options, including advanced dual-clutch systems that ensure smooth and responsive gear shifts. Both front-wheel-drive and all-wheel-drive configurations are available, allowing the Sportage to handle diverse driving conditions with confidence.

A Sleek and Spacious Design

At 4515 mm long, the Sportage strikes a harmonious balance between offering a compact exterior for city driving while maximising interior space. With seating for five and a generous boot capacity ranging from 526 to 587 litres, the Sportage is designed with practicality in mind. The added benefit of a low aerodynamics-enhancing stance contributes to its efficiency and dynamic performance.

Suzuki S-Cross

Introducing the Versatile Suzuki S-Cross

The Suzuki S-Cross stands out as a remarkable offering in the competitive SUV market, combining practicality with modern technology. This car is designed to cater to a diverse range of drivers, offering innovative hybrid technology alongside a comfortable and spacious interior.

Efficient Performance: The Heart of the S-Cross

At the core of the Suzuki S-Cross are its hybrid engine options. Customers can choose between a mild-hybrid or a full-hybrid engine, which both provide impressive fuel efficiency and driveability. The mild-hybrid 1.4 Boosterjet comes with a manual transmission, while the 1.5 Dualjet full-hybrid offers an automatic option. This flexibility ensures that there's an S-Cross model for everyone.

Technical Brilliance and Engineering

The Suzuki S-Cross excels with a range of technical specifications. Offering between 116 to 129 PS, the vehicle also boasts a CO2 efficiency class of D, maintaining an eco-friendly performance with CO2 emissions ranging from 118 to 132 g/km. With a top speed of up to 195 km/h and a nimble 0-100 km/h acceleration of just 9.5 seconds, the S-Cross demonstrates dynamic capability without compromising on environmental consciousness.

Innovative Design and Spacious Comfort

The exterior dimensions, with a length of 4300 mm, a width of 1785 mm, and a height of 1580 mm, provide a substantial presence while offering a spacious interior. The boot space of 430 litres, combined with a seating capacity for five, ensures that the S-Cross is as practical as it is comfortable.

Driving Experience and Versatility

The S-Cross provides a choice between front-wheel drive and the all-terrain ALLGRIP all-wheel-drive system, allowing for flexibility depending on the driver's needs. The suspension and handling have been finely tuned to deliver a smooth driving experience across various conditions, further underscoring the vehicle's versatility.
